Clear Instructions
Clear instructions are vital as they ensure AI understands and responds appropriately. Providing explicit and detailed task instructions leads to more targeted AI outputs. Conciseness in prompts is vital; excessive details can confuse AI and dilute effectiveness.
Using bullet points or numbered lists for complex instructions can make them more digestible for the AI. For example, when handling phone calls, specifying the call duration, expected script flow, and key points to cover can significantly enhance the AI’s performance.

Leveraging Retrieval-Augmented Generation (RAG)
Retrieval-Augmented Generation (RAG) can significantly enhance the responsiveness of AI voice agents. RAG combines retrieval-based and generative models to improve AI performance and response accuracy. RAG combines large language models with external knowledge sources, allowing AI to incorporate up-to-date information from diverse data sources.
Integrating vector databases within RAG enables efficient retrieval of semantically similar data, improving response times and relevance. This approach ensures AI responses are both accurate and relevant to the current context.
Implementing Function Calls in AI Voice Agents
Function calls in AI voice agents are essential for efficient task management. Function declarations must follow a structured schema format compatible with OpenAPI for proper integration. Best practices include giving clear and detailed function names and descriptions to avoid confusion.
Models can handle parallel function calls, enabling simultaneous execution of multiple tasks. This capability is crucial for AI voice agents in customer service operations, where they need to manage various tasks concurrently.
